New Engines Force New Pistons

As engines get smaller, motorists expect the same performance as a larger V6 or V8 but with the fuel economy of a four cylinder. Turbocharging makes little engines breathe big, but it also increases the load and temperature the pistons have to endure. This, in turn, requires pistons made of alloys that can withstand higher temperatures and combustion pressures. Yesterday’s castings won’t cut it for these kinds of applications.

Headmaster Jagersberger – Converting Flatheads into OHV Engines

Joseph W. Jagersberger was a very early racing car driver who competed against Louis Chevrolet prior to the first Indianapolis 500-mile Race. He was also the manufacturer of early speed equipment and his RAJO heads became well known to Ford and Chevy lovers.

The Unique Engines of ARCA

ARCA uses older style NASCAR Cup cars. Specifically, they are the ones used just before the advent of NASCAR’s Car Of Tomorrow (COT) in 2007. This means teams running ARCA can do so with a safe, well-built race car without paying top dollar.

Two of a Kind – Dodge Bros. Celebrate 100 Years

Engine builders John and Horace Dodge started making automobiles in 1914 — 100 years ago. However, the Dodge brothers actually got into the automobile industry in 1900 and actually manufactured engines under contract to Henry Ford in 1900.
